Could Remote Therapy Be a Good Fit?
Many people wonder whether online therapy truly helps. For common concerns such as stress, anxiety, depression, relationship challenges, or navigating life transitions, online therapy has been shown to be comparable in effectiveness to traditional in-person sessions.One major benefit is flexibility. Individuals can connect with a therapist in the format that suits them best - video sessions, phone calls, live chat, or text-based messaging - which makes it easier to fit support into busy routines and varied schedules.
Therapists offering remote care are licensed professionals, and clients can change therapists if they feel a different fit would be more helpful. For many people, online therapy offers a practical, accessible way to begin or continue therapeutic work while maintaining continuity and convenience.
